September Tuesday Forum: Readying People & Communities for Change

Tuesday, 7 Sep
7:00 pmto9:00 pm

As much a workshop as a lecture, the forum will be presented by Debra Mill who has spent over 15 years  helping individuals and communities develop resilience in dealing with the challenge of change. Her  presentation will focus upon the importance of understanding the psychology of change, both for individuals and for communities. It is a complex issue; “approaches to change are ultimately guided by a person’s beliefs, culture and worldview” says Debra “so what you say may not be what the person hears”.  The workshop on Readying People and Communities for Change will be on Tuesday 7th September at 7pm at Kent House, Faulkner Street, opposite Central Park.
